Literature summary for 3.4.24.7 extracted from

  • Liu, X.; Yu, J.; Jiang, L.; Wang, A.; Shi, F.; Ye, H.; Zhou, X.
    MicroRNA-222 regulates cell invasion by targeting matrix metalloproteinase 1 (MMP1) and manganese superoxide dismutase 2 (SOD2) in tongue squamous cell carcinoma cell lines (2009), Cancer Genomics Proteomics, 6, 131-139.
    View publication on PubMedView publication on EuropePMC

Protein Variants

Protein Variants Comment Organism
additional information transfection of oral tongue squamous cell carcinoma cells with microRNA candidates, including hsa-miR-222, reduces the expression of MMP1 and SOD2 in the cells, direct targeting of hsa-miR-222 to specific sequences located in the 3'-untranslated regions of both MMP1 and SOD2, overview Homo sapiens
